Description

2-Pyrenecarbaldehyde is a high-purity, functionalized polycyclic aromatic hydrocarbon (PAH) derivative, serving as a critical building block in advanced materials science and organic synthesis. Its value lies in the reactive aldehyde group attached to the pyrene core, enabling precise chemical modifications to tune electronic and photophysical properties. This compound is essential for researchers and manufacturers in the fields of organic electronics, fluorescent probes, and polymer chemistry.

Application

  • Organic Light-Emitting Diodes (OLEDs): Used as a key precursor for electron-transport materials and host molecules in emissive layers.
  • Fluorescent Sensors and Probes: Serves as a starting material for synthesizing pyrene-based fluorophores with high quantum yields for chemical and biological sensing.
  • Polymer and Dendrimer Synthesis: Acts as a functional monomer or cross-linking agent for creating conjugated polymers and dendritic structures with enhanced luminescence.
  • Liquid Crystal and Supramolecular Chemistry: Employed to construct discotic liquid crystals or supramolecular assemblies due to the planar, π-conjugated pyrene system.
  • Photocatalysis and Energy Materials: Investigated as a component in molecular systems for light-harvesting and charge transfer applications.
  • Academic and Pharmaceutical Research: Utilized as a versatile synthetic intermediate in medicinal chemistry and materials research laboratories.

Basic Information

Product Name 2-Pyrenecarbaldehyde
CAS No. 26933-87-9
Molecular Formula C₁₇H₁₀O
Molecular Weight 230.26 g/mol
Synonyms Pyrene-2-carboxaldehyde; 2-Formylpyrene; 2-Pyrenecarboxaldehyde; Pyrene-2-carbaldehyde; 2-Pyrenylcarboxaldehyde; 2-Pyrenealdehyde; β-Pyrenecarboxaldehyde; NSC 404088

Storage

Preserve in a tightly closed container, protected from light. Store under an inert atmosphere (e.g., nitrogen or argon) in a cool, dry place at room temperature (15-25°C). This product is light-sensitive and easily oxidized; prolonged exposure to air and light should be avoided to maintain stability.
